Merge branch 'pci/resource'
- Prevent assigning space to unimplemented bridge windows; previously we
mistakenly assumed prefetchable window existed and assigned space and put
a BAR there (Ahmed Naseef)
- Avoid shrinking bridge windows to fit in the initial Root Port window;
this fixes one problem with devices with large BARs connected via
switches, e.g., Thunderbolt (Ilpo Järvinen)
- Retain information about optional resources to make assignment during
rescan more likely to succeed (Ilpo Järvinen)
- Add __resource_contains_unbound() for use in finding space for resources
with no address assigned (Ilpo Järvinen)
- Pass full extent of empty space, not just the aligned space, to
resource_alignf callback so free space before the requested alignment can
be used (Ilpo Järvinen)
- Remove unnecessary second alignment from ARM, m68k, MIPS (Ilpo Järvinen)
- Place small resources before larger ones for better utilization of
address space (Ilpo Järvinen)
- Fix alignment calculation for resource size larger than align, e.g.,
bridge windows larger than the 1MB required alignment (Ilpo Järvinen)
